We are seeking an experienced, high-level professional to join us as a Case Management Coordinator, ODP. This role reports directly to the PA ODP Program Lead and is a full-time hybrid position based in Eastern Pennsylvania.

As a Case Management Coordinator for ODP, you will go beyond standard case management & scheduling. You will serve as a strategic partner to the Program Lead, assisting in the pre-admission lifecycle and building high-level relationships with Support Coordination Organizations (SCOs) and County MH/ID offices, in addition to supporting our operational team with ODP subject matter expertise. We are looking for an IDD program veteran who understands the nuances of the Pennsylvania ODP waiver landscape and is ready to take a leadership role in strategic operations through care management and expanding our community footprint.

This is a Full-Time Hybrid opportunity based in Philadelphia, PA.

  • Manage a caseload of ODP individuals, ensuring high-quality care across Easters/Central PA.

  • Provide coaching, oversight, and mentorship to Direct Support Professionals (DSPs) to ensure adherence to ODP standards, with support from the HR/Onboarding team.

  • Facilitate starts of care (in-person) for the Eastern PA region. Attend ISP meetings, SIS assessments (when necessary), and monitoring meetings. This role requires client check-ins with individual caseloads on a bi-annual basis (virtually or in-person).

  • Ensure implementation of the Individual Support Plans (ISPs) is being met through updated records, documentation and quarterly reporting. (EMR oversight)

  • Manage staff schedules for individual caseload. Oversee timely completion of accurate electronic documentation and service notes for caseload.

  • Auditing schedules weekly in preparation for the pre-billing teams

  • Provide education to families when needed on service definitions, and compliance.

  • Provide updates to the Payroll/Pre-Billing team on documentation and EVV records to ensure they meet ODP regulatory requirements prior to submission.

  • Caseload Excellence: Provide training, coaching, oversight, and mentorship to the wider incoming Care Coordination team to ensure adherence to ODP standards.

  • Primary Escalation Point: Serve as the first point of contact for Community Care Coordinators (CCCs) regarding incidents, complex individual concerns, or billing obstacles.

  • Audit Management: Conducts quarterly reviews of documentation, EVV, and service notes to ensure they meet ODP 6100 regulations. Completed reports and sent to SCO for visibility quarterly.

  • Incident Management: Oversee the EIM (Enterprise Incident Management) process, ensuring all incidents are reported to the state accurately and within mandatory timeframes.

  • Complaints and QA: tracking and managing incoming complaints for record keeping and AE communications

  • QA&I/QMP: participating alongside the ODP Lead to develop and roll out Quality Assurance and Incident Management audits in addition to quarterly meetings regarding Quality Management Planning.

  • Internal Reporting: Communicate high-level regional updates, systemic risks, or performance trends to the ODP Lead.

  • Experience working within an Office of Developmental Programs (ODP) Role: e.g., Support Coordination, Program Management, Residential Director, for at least 2 years, or ODP various field experience for at least 4 years. Minimum 2 years of direct experience within the Pennsylvania ODP space (required).

  • Strong familiarity with ODP waiver regulations, HCSIS, EVV, PROMISe, and the ISP process.

  • Experience in SCO relationships, documentation systems (EMR/EHR) and knowledge of EVV requirements

  • A valid driver’s license and reliable transportation.
